A Fine Day For a Canoe Trip

Family forges on with birthday party despite rain.

The rain came a little early Saturday, but that didn't stop Jack Castineiras of Farmington from celebrating his 7th birthday with a canoe ride.

Jack and some of his friends went forward with a birthday party at . Despite the rain that came before noon, they were still able to paddle.

"We're not letting the rain get in our way," said his mother Meg.

While the kids were having an unforgettable party, owner Jon Warner and Randy Pavel were busy moving kayaks inside and securing canoes and other items as much as possible.

The rain dampened other plans as well. Around 11 a.m., a group of cyclists from http://healthygears.com/ were putting their bikes away on cars in the town hall parking lot after cutting their Saturday morning ride short due to the earlier than expected rain.
